Niche attackers - Tangela, Scyther, Parasect

I've got a couple of 1000cp Tangela's and wondered whether anyone had powered one up to use against Vaporeans?

Similarly I've three Parasect of the same level and a 1200 Scyther and wondered about powering up for Slowpoke/Eggecutor bashing duties.

I seem to always rely on 2000 Vaporeans for grinding out wins.

Does anyone use specialised attackers?

I powered up a 93 Scyther to 1757 with good attacks and use it almost exclusively against Eggsecutors. With the new team-training however, it's not necessary. It used to be that a 2200 Egg at the base of the gym meant you could no longer train it efficiently... that just isn't the case anymore. Jynx, Parasect, Scyther can all take down the Giant palm Tree well. Dragonite still tends to do it better (although the Breath animation gets in the way of seeing the Zen Headbutt for dodging purposes)

I use Butterfree to destroy Exeggutor. Those Bug Buzzes do insane damage, but you need to be super careful not to take a Psychic or Solar Beam to the face since Bug Buzz's animation is very long (~4 secs).

So here's the issue: niche attackers are, well, niche. Assuming that you have a finite amount of stardust, I think it's a waste to power up a pokemon like Scyther when you could power up a pokemon like Arcanine instead. First of all, while yes, Scyther's moveset is better for taking out Exeggcutor, the difference isn't that large: bug attacks do 1.56x damage while fire attacks "only" do 1.25x damage. Second, Arcanine has uses beyond just taking out Exeggutor - he makes a good anti-grass, anti-ice attacker and can be deployed at the top of a gym to get you several days' worth of gold. Third, niche pokemon tend to be very squishy - one charge move and they're gone. I'd rather not risk the fate of the battle on the stability of my Internet connection (or my sluggish dodging fingers, especially once it gets cold out)!

tl;dr - Powering up tier 1-2 pokemon will give more overall bang for your buck than niche 'mons.
